Elastic Shares Jump on 3Q Revenue Surge, Growth Outlook

Elastic shares jumped 13% in premarket trading after its latest results outperformed expectations and the company forecast further growth.

Shares were trading around $114.56. The stock is down about 13% over the last year.

The data analytics company reported revenue of $382.1 million in the third quarter ended Jan. 31, above the $369 million expected by Wall Street. Chief Executive Ash Kulkarni said continued interest from customers building generative artificial intelligence applications and consolidating onto a single platform helped drive the outperformance in the quarter.

Elastic forecast revenue between $379 million and $381 million in the fourth quarter of fiscal 2025, while the street expected $379.2 million. For fiscal 2025, the company guided for revenue between $1.474 billion and $1.476 billion, while analysts polled by FactSet expected $1.471 billion.
